Solar Overtakes Coal as China's Largest Power Source for the First Time
China's installed solar capacity has edged past coal for the first time — a historic crossover in the world's biggest power system that state media celebrated, then immediately qualified: capacity is not generation, and the sun still sets.
A quiet line in the National Energy Administration's data, reported this week, marks a shift in the world's largest power system: as of the end of July, China's installed solar capacity had reached 1.286 billion kilowatts, overtaking coal — at 1.285 billion kilowatts — for the first time. The country that built its industrial rise on coal now has more solar panels mounted than coal-fired turbines, and the state's own broadcasters led with the word "historic."

Solar installations in China now lead those of any single country and exceed the combined photovoltaic capacity of the European Union, the report noted; Jiangsu, the manufacturing province, became in mid-August the first province to pass 100 million kilowatts of solar on its own, with distributed rooftop installations — panels on homes and factories rather than desert-scale farms — making up nearly seventy percent of it.
Scale, though, is not the same as electricity. The report was careful, in a way that became part of the story itself, to flag the caveat: solar's capacity factor is far lower than coal's, because the sun sets. Measured by actual generation, coal remains China's backbone and will for years to come, standing by as the system's safety net. A panel fleet that has just edged past coal in name still cannot be counted on through a windless, overcast winter evening peak.
What happens next is the real subject of the coverage: the attempt to build what Chinese planners call a "new power system" around an intermittent source. The recipe as described runs from giant pumped-storage and battery installations — likened to "power banks" for the grid — to giving coal a new job as a flexible, peaking plant rather than a baseload workhorse, to experiments in solar-plus-storage, solar thermal, and hydrogen. The phrase used was that solar must move from "living off the weather" to being dispatchable and predictable: generated when needed, sent where needed, used well.
For an outside reader, the significance is less the ribbon-cutting than the trajectory. Coal's share of Chinese generating capacity has been ceding ground for a decade; the crossover point — the moment the largest clean source became the largest source, period — has now been crossed years into a build-out that shows no sign of slowing. The open question, exactly as the state commentary framed it, is whether China can convert its unmatched ability to deploy panels into the harder, less photogenic work of grids, storage, and market rules that make the power usable when the sun is not shining.
